Despite all of the different ways people are telling you to do it in this thread, they've all got one thing in common, and it's the one thing that will help you get there: GOALS. Even your name, haha.
Set a goal each day and aim for it. For a while I was aiming to get 5% a day when I wasn't really motivated, just to keep the ball rolling. Make it so the goal is attainable or you will get discouraged. If you're someone who works harder when they have something that they want to achieve, then set your goal a little higher than what you know you can do each day. In the long run, that little bit extra will make up a whole lot. If you struggle to just sit through the 2.5 hours, then make it a little less than what you know you can get. That way, even if you don't make it through the 2.5 hours, you don't feel like the day was a big loss.
